Jewish-American Heritage Month
Learn about Jewish American Heritage Month, celebrated nationally from May 1 through May 30. UC San Diego proudly celebrates its inaugural Jewish American Heritage Month, a federally-recognized observance honoring the profound contributions of Jewish Americans to the nation’s culture, history, science, arts, civil rights, military service, and more!
All faculty, staff, alumni, and students are invited to participate in JAHM 2025 activities featuring numerous free programs centered on the theme “Kehillah” (community).
